Two explosions hit IRGC base in Tehran 

Two explosions rattled the Malek Ashtar base of Iran’s Revolutionary Guard’s paramilitary force Basij militia in the southeast of the capital Tehran late Friday, Report informs, citing Iran International.

Videos shared on social media showed fire and smoke billowing from the base.

In a statement, the exiled Iranian opposition group Mujahedin-e Khalq Organization (MEK) claimed the attack was carried out by “revolutionary cells," a term it often uses to characterize anti-regime acts and protests in Iran. The group, which used large-scale violence in the 1980s and 1990s in its fight against the Islamic Republic, later distanced itself from armed attacks.
